The Free People story begins in the 1970s, when founder Dick Hayne opened the brand’s first brick-and-mortar store in West Philadelphia. Over time, the eclectic label evolved into Urban Outfitters, but later, in 1984, Free People was relaunched as its own entity. Designed with a romantic, adventurous aesthetic, Free People caters to a contemporary bohemian lifestyle, highlighting creative spirit and effortless confidence with a unique do-it-yourself sensibility.
